emory | newborn | nashville, tn photographer

I have to say in-home lifestyle newborn sessions are my FAVORITE. There is something so personal and special about spending time with the family in the comfort of their own home. I try my best to stay out of their way and let them just be a family…let them love on their new little one and capture those tender moments. As much as I love studio newborn sessions and using cute props, to me it just doesn’t capture the emotion I believe in-home lifestyle sessions do. Nothing is more personal than the backdrop of your own home, the baby’s nursery, and mom and dads room. Joe and Megan welcomed me into their home with open arms and I’m so grateful for it. Watching them love on their baby girl Emory and seeing how they interacted with each other truly gave me a glimpse of how wonderful they are. Emory is one lucky lady to have such wonderful and loving parents. Congratulations Joe and Megan on your beautiful baby girl Emory!
